A living planet lays on the horizon, as humanity searches for a new home in The Signal

It’s the far future, and Earth is a memory for mankind, who searches the stars for a new world in open-world survival title The Signal.

A new home in the stars

There’re plenty of people who believe humans will eventually have to move out from Earth, and that element is the main impetus for the story in the just announced The Signal. From Canadian studio Goose Byte, The Signal is an open-world, survival-centric multiplayer title. But it’s not what you might be expecting, as on top of all of that, it also pushes “player creativity over violence”.

Here’s your first look:

The last remaining humans have abandoned Earth in search of a new home. Humanity’s future relies on an expedition led by you to scout an uncharted planet. But how welcome will you be in a world that appears to be sentient? 

Goose Byte press release

Created in Unreal 5, The Signal is both multiplayer and open-world. Goose Byte says that its living world will play host to multiple biomes for players to explore, build, and survive in. But even with de-emphasized action, you won’t be alone. Aside from other players (there’ll be 16 at a time), The Signal’s world will be dotted with plenty of flora and fauna, plus some alien landmarks to boot.

The game is currently without a release date, but is in active development for both consoles and the PC.
